GNU/Linux >> LINUX-Kenntnisse >  >> Ubuntu

So installieren Sie Memcached auf Ubuntu 16.04 / 14.04 / LinuxMint 18 / 17

Memcached ist ein kostenloses und quelloffenes Hochleistungs-Caching-System für verteilte Speicherobjekte , generischer Natur, aber zur Beschleunigung dynamischer Webanwendungen gedacht, indem die Datenbankbelastung verringert wird.

Es ist ein speicherinterner Schlüsselwertspeicher für kleine Mengen beliebiger Daten (Strings, Objekte) aus Ergebnissen von Datenbankaufrufen, API-Aufrufen oder Seitenwiedergabe.

Memcached ist einfach, aber leistungsstark . Sein einfaches Design fördert eine schnelle Bereitstellung, eine einfache Entwicklung und löst viele Probleme, die mit großen Datencaches verbunden sind. Seine API ist für die gängigsten Sprachen verfügbar.

Hier werden wir die Schritte zur Installation von Memcached auf  Ubuntu durchgehen und Linux Mint Betriebssystem.

Terminal öffnen ( Strg + Alt + T ).

Memcache installieren

Installieren Sie Memcached mit dem folgenden Befehl.

sudo apt-get install -y memcached

Bearbeiten Sie den Memcache Konfigurationsdatei zum Ändern/Aktivieren der Funktionen.

sudo nano /etc/memcached.conf

In der Konfigurationsdatei sind einige Standardeinstellungen verfügbar, ändern Sie sie (falls erforderlich). Das Folgende sind Beispieleinstellungen für 64 MB Caching, Sie müssen die lauschende IP-Adresse auskommentieren, um alle IP-Adressen zu lauschen.

# memory
-m 64

# Default connection port is 11211
-p 11211

# -u command is present in this config file
-u memcache

# listening ip address
#-l 127.0.0.1

Starten Sie Memcache.

sudo service memcached start

Um Memcached beim Booten automatisch zu starten.

sudo chkconfig memcached on

Bestätigen Sie den Memcache-Laufstatus.

echo stats | nc localhost 11211

Ausgabe:

STAT pid 1370
STAT uptime 2119
STAT time 1331977895
STAT version 1.4.7
STAT libevent 2.0.12-stable
STAT pointer_size 32
STAT rusage_user 0.084005
STAT rusage_system 0.000000
STAT curr_connections 10
STAT total_connections 13
STAT connection_structures 11
STAT cmd_get 0
STAT cmd_set 0
STAT cmd_flush 0
STAT get_hits 0
STAT get_misses 0
STAT delete_misses 0
STAT delete_hits 0
STAT incr_misses 0
STAT incr_hits 0
STAT decr_misses 0
STAT decr_hits 0
STAT cas_misses 0
STAT cas_hits 0
STAT cas_badval 0
STAT auth_cmds 0
STAT auth_errors 0
STAT bytes_read 18
STAT bytes_written 1635
STAT limit_maxbytes 67108864
STAT accepting_conns 1
STAT listen_disabled_num 0
STAT threads 4
STAT conn_yields 0
STAT bytes 0
STAT curr_items 0
STAT total_items 0
STAT evictions 0
STAT reclaimed 0
END

Installieren Sie das PHP-Modul

Installieren Sie das Memcached-PHP-Modul, um mit PHP5 zu arbeiten.

sudo apt-get install -y apache2 php php-memcache libapache2-mod-php

Starten Sie jetzt den Memcached- und Apache-Server neu, damit die Änderungen wirksam werden.

sudo service memcached restart
sudo service apache2 restart

Das ist alles.


Ubuntu
  1. So installieren Sie R unter Ubuntu 20.04

  2. So installieren Sie Linux Kernel 4.3 auf Ubuntu &LinuxMint

  3. So installieren Sie Python 3.5 unter Ubuntu, Debian und Linuxmint

  4. So installieren Sie Python 2.7.18 unter Ubuntu und LinuxMint

  5. So installieren Sie Python 3.6 unter Ubuntu und LinuxMint

So installieren Sie qt unter Ubuntu 20.04

So installieren Sie Memcached auf Ubuntu 15.04

So installieren Sie Memcached auf Ubuntu 16.04 LTS

So installieren Sie Memcached auf Ubuntu 18.04 LTS

So installieren Sie Memcached auf Ubuntu 20.04 LTS

So installieren und sichern Sie Memcached unter Ubuntu 18.04